Flat Roof Replacement cost: Danville vs Richmond (2026)

In 2026, flat roof replacement is about 4% less expensive in Danville than in Richmond. Most homeowners pay around $9,800 in Danville versus $10,150 in Richmond — a gap of roughly $350.

Flat roof replacement by roof size: Danville vs Richmond

Flat and low-slope roofs are priced per square (100 sq ft) and run about $3–$11 per sq ft installed, depending on the membrane. The roof area is close to the footprint since there's little pitch.

Where does a smart roofing budget go in 2026?

Two roofs of the same square footage can price hundreds apart because of something you can't see from the ground — the deck under the old shingles. Add the tear-off-versus-overlay call and the shingle grade, and you have the decisions that actually move the number.

The do-it-right case

A full tear-off lets the crew replace underlayment, flashing and ventilation while the deck is exposed — the layers that actually keep water out. Covering old shingles with new ones costs less on install day, but the trapped heat shortens shingle life, and many manufacturers won't honor a warranty on an overlay.

The risk case

The surprise that wrecks a roofing budget is rot in the decking, and you rarely see it until the old shingles come off. Fix the price per replacement sheet in the contract before the crew starts, so a low bid can't quietly climb once the deck is open.

The value case

Architectural shingles sit between bargain 3-tab and premium metal or tile, and for most houses that middle ground is exactly right. They carry longer wind and wear ratings than 3-tab for a small step up in price, without the four-figure jump metal or tile demands.

Our take

The two things that actually protect a roofing budget are a real tear-off and a written rate for any deck repairs found along the way. The cheapest post-storm bid usually isn't the cheapest roof, long-term.
